Szarobrązowe młode rodzą się ślepe i nieporadne, oczy otwierają w drugim tygodniu życia. Po około eight tygodniach młode przestają przyjmować mleko matki i zaczynają dostawać lekko nadtrawiony pokarm mięsny. Rodzice opiekują się młodymi do piątego miesiąca życia, później podrostki zaczynają polować wraz z rodzicami (Nowak, 1999). Zarówno samce jak i samice osiągają dojrzałość płciową w pierwszym roku życia. Nie poznano jeszcze dokładnie placełu i powierzchni terytorium jaki zajmuje stado psów leśnych, jedno jest pewne, w zależności od warunków siedliskowych, wielkości stada i dostępnego pokarmu jest on różny (Lounak, 2007). Mimo że psy leśne są w dużym stopniu towarzyskie, na ogół polują indywidualnie. Samce w nieco dziwny sposób zaznaczają swoje terytorium, nie podnoszą tylnej nogi, jak to robią inne psy, ale podczas oznaczania cały tułów zostaje oparty na tylnych kończynach o jakiś przedmiot np. drzewo lub część skały. Psy leśne w naturalnym środowisku dożywają ten lat.
